在Ubuntu中,如果你使用的是SQL Server的sqladmin
工具,并且不小心删除了数据,你可以尝试以下方法来恢复:
从备份中恢复:如果你有数据库的备份,那么这是最简单、最安全的方法。只需将备份文件还原到数据库服务器上,覆盖被删除的数据。
使用事务日志备份:如果你的数据库使用了完整恢复模式,并且有事务日志备份,那么你可以使用这些备份来恢复数据。具体步骤如下:
a. 确定删除数据的时间点。
b. 从最早的事务日志备份开始,还原所有后续的事务日志备份,直到达到删除数据的时间点。
c. 还原最后一个事务日志备份,但将其恢复模式设置为“大容量日志恢复”。
d. 还原包含被删除数据的数据库。
使用第三方数据恢复工具:如果以上方法都无法恢复数据,你可以尝试使用第三方数据恢复工具,如ApexSQL Log、Stellar Repair for MS SQL等。这些工具可以帮助你扫描数据库的事务日志,找到被删除的数据并将其恢复。请注意,这种方法可能需要一定的技术知识,并且不能保证100%成功。
联系专业数据恢复服务:如果以上方法都无法解决问题,你可以考虑联系专业的数据恢复服务。他们可能有更多的经验和资源来帮助你恢复数据。
在未来,为了避免类似的问题,建议定期备份数据库,并在执行删除操作之前仔细检查。此外,可以考虑限制具有删除权限的用户数量,以减少误删除的风险。